Former Ukroboronprom rose 24 positions in the ranking of global defence companies

The state concern Ukroboronprom (now JSC Ukrainian Defence Industry) has risen to 65th place in the ranking of the world's defence companies by revenue, according to Defense News.

Previously, the Ukrainian Defence Industry held 89th place in this ranking. In the 18 months since the beginning of the full-scale invasion, the company has moved up 24 positions.

The statistical data indicates that the company's revenue in 2022 was 1.28 billion, compared to 754.75 million dollars in 2021, showing a 70% increase.

Just over half of the hundred companies on the list are American. Thirty-one companies are located in Europe.

Background. Recall that at the end of June, the state concern Ukroboronprom was reorganised into a joint-stock company Ukrainian Defence Industry as part of corporatisation.

The Cabinet of Ministers approved the director of the Malyshev Plant in Kharkiv, Herman Smetanin, as the new head of the state concern Ukroboronprom.
